Toolbar does not display correctly

I am experiencing a problem with the toolbar displaying correctly on my help screen.  When I click on help from the web application, it displays correctly.  When I maximize the IE window, I get garbage charaters in the toolbar section of the help screen.  How do I resolve this issue?  Thanks!

I had this issue with the sidebar. After manually deleting the folder from windows explorer and purging the CPD file, it went away.

I continued to research the issue and I believe I found the solution.  I unchecked the "Enable Static Content Compression" checkbox under "Compression" for the web application in IIS.
